概括
脑卒中后抑郁症 (PSD) 是中风后的常见疾病,影响患者的康复. 准确的诊断包括考虑中风的位置,症状和时间,以区分它与其他情绪障碍.

背景情况:
- 卒中幸存者经常经历身体,认知,语言和社会障碍.
- 脑卒中后抑郁症 (PSD) 是一个重要的并发症,可以预测患者的结果.
- 诊断PSD是具有挑战性的,因为与中风相关的身体变化重叠的症状,风险低诊断.

主要成果:
- PSD被归类为一种有机情绪障碍.
- 准确的诊断可能涉及考虑中风的位置,症状表现和发病时间表 (症状>1年后中风降低PSD的可能性).
- 病因学涉及生理学,心理社会因素及其相互作用,包括炎症,HPA轴调节失调,氧化应激和网络功能障碍等机制.
结论:
- 准确的PSD诊断需要仔细考虑中风特异性因素和症状时间.
- PSD是由生物和心理社会元素之间的复杂相互作用造成的.
- 需要进一步的研究来阐明PSD机制并改进管理策略.

Long-term depression, or LTD, is one of the ways by which synaptic plasticity—changes in the strength of chemical synapses—can occur in the brain. LTD is the process of synaptic weakening that occurs over time between pre and postsynaptic neuronal connections. The synaptic weakening of LTD works in opposition to synaptic strengthening by long-term potentiation (LTP) and together are the main mechanisms that underlie learning and memory.
